Riches of the Empire

Type: Atlas Notable

Tree: Incursion subtree

Cost: 6 Atlas points from the Incursion start

Temple Currency found inside the Temple has 15% chance to be duplicated

Getting there

The shortest chain of nodes you allocate from the Incursion subtree's start, which is why Riches of the Empire costs 6 points. The start node itself is free.

  1. 1.Reduced Destabilization
  2. 2.Training and Preparation
  3. 3.Reduced Destabilization
  4. 4.Bloodrite Vestments
  5. 5.Reduced Destabilization
  6. 6.Riches of the Empire
